install_anon() {
echo -e ""
echo -e "${BLUE}========================================${NOCOLOR}"
echo -e "${GREEN}Step 1.5: Install Anyone Relay (Anon)${NOCOLOR}"
echo -e "${BLUE}========================================${NOCOLOR}"
echo -e ""
log "Installing Anyone relay for anonymous networking..."
# Check if anon is already installed
if command -v anon &>/dev/null; then
success "Anon already installed"
configure_anon_logs
configure_firewall_for_anon
return 0
fi
# Install via APT (official method from docs.anyone.io)
log "Adding Anyone APT repository..."
# Add GPG key
if ! curl -fsSL https://deb.anyone.io/gpg.key | sudo gpg --dearmor -o /usr/share/keyrings/anyone-archive-keyring.gpg 2>/dev/null; then
warning "Failed to add Anyone GPG key"
log "You can manually install later with:"
log " curl -fsSL https://deb.anyone.io/gpg.key | sudo gpg --dearmor -o /usr/share/keyrings/anyone-archive-keyring.gpg"
log " echo 'deb [signed-by=/usr/share/keyrings/anyone-archive-keyring.gpg] https://deb.anyone.io/ anyone main' | sudo tee /etc/apt/sources.list.d/anyone.list"
log " sudo apt update && sudo apt install -y anon"
return 1
fi
# Add repository
echo "deb [signed-by=/usr/share/keyrings/anyone-archive-keyring.gpg] https://deb.anyone.io/ anyone main" | sudo tee /etc/apt/sources.list.d/anyone.list >/dev/null
# Update and install
log "Installing Anon package..."
sudo apt update -qq
if ! sudo apt install -y anon; then
warning "Anon installation failed"
return 1
fi
# Verify installation
if ! command -v anon &>/dev/null; then
warning "Anon installation may have failed"
return 1
fi
success "Anon installed successfully"
# Configure with sensible defaults
configure_anon_defaults
# Configure log directory
configure_anon_logs
# Configure firewall if present
configure_firewall_for_anon
# Enable and start service
log "Enabling Anon service..."
sudo systemctl enable anon 2>/dev/null || true
sudo systemctl start anon 2>/dev/null || true
if systemctl is-active --quiet anon; then
success "Anon service is running"
else
warning "Anon service may not be running. Check: sudo systemctl status anon"
fi
return 0
}

configure_firewall_for_anon() {
log "Checking firewall configuration..."
# Check for UFW
if command -v ufw &>/dev/null && sudo ufw status | grep -q "Status: active"; then
log "UFW detected and active, adding Anon ports..."
sudo ufw allow 9001/tcp comment 'Anon ORPort' 2>/dev/null || true
sudo ufw allow 9051/tcp comment 'Anon ControlPort' 2>/dev/null || true
success "UFW rules added for Anon"
return 0
fi
# Check for firewalld
if command -v firewall-cmd &>/dev/null && sudo firewall-cmd --state 2>/dev/null | grep -q "running"; then
log "firewalld detected and active, adding Anon ports..."
sudo firewall-cmd --permanent --add-port=9001/tcp 2>/dev/null || true
sudo firewall-cmd --permanent --add-port=9051/tcp 2>/dev/null || true
sudo firewall-cmd --reload 2>/dev/null || true
success "firewalld rules added for Anon"
return 0
fi
# Check for iptables
if command -v iptables &>/dev/null; then
# Check if iptables has any rules (indicating it's in use)
if sudo iptables -L -n | grep -q "Chain INPUT"; then
log "iptables detected, adding Anon ports..."
sudo iptables -A INPUT -p tcp --dport 9001 -j ACCEPT -m comment --comment "Anon ORPort" 2>/dev/null || true
sudo iptables -A INPUT -p tcp --dport 9051 -j ACCEPT -m comment --comment "Anon ControlPort" 2>/dev/null || true
# Try to save rules if iptables-persistent is available
if command -v netfilter-persistent &>/dev/null; then
sudo netfilter-persistent save 2>/dev/null || true
elif command -v iptables-save &>/dev/null; then
sudo iptables-save | sudo tee /etc/iptables/rules.v4 >/dev/null 2>&1 || true
fi
success "iptables rules added for Anon"
return 0
fi
fi
log "No active firewall detected, skipping firewall configuration"
}
